Matching Your Home's Decor
One of the primary factors to consider is the style and overall look of your home. Woolen carpets are known for their soft texture and rich colors, making them a versatile option for various decor styles. Whether you're aiming for a modern, traditional, or rustic look, there's a woolen carpet that can complement your existing decor. Take the time to analyze your current design elements such as wall colors, furniture finishes, and lighting. For example, a contemporary home might benefit from a woolen carpet with a simple, geometric pattern, while a traditional home might look better with a more elaborate design. Properly pairing your carpet with your existing decor can enhance the overall aesthetic of your space.
Consider the Traffic Volume
Another important consideration is the amount of traffic in your home. Different areas of your house experience different levels of foot traffic, and this can affect the carpet you choose. High-traffic areas such as hallways and living rooms require a more durable and stain-resistant carpet, whereas bedrooms and offices can have softer, more luxurious options.
Quality and Durability of Woolen Carpets
Wool is known for its exceptional quality and durability, which makes it a popular choice for people looking for long-lasting floor coverings. However, the level of quality can vary across different manufacturers. Look for woolen carpets with high wool content and check for certifications or brand reputations that ensure the carpet's quality. Additionally, consider the pile height, as a higher pile can provide more cushioning and durability, ideal for areas with heavy foot traffic.
Maintenance and Care
While woolen carpets are generally low-maintenance, it's essential to understand the care requirements to ensure they last longer. Regular vacuuming, routine cleaning, and prompt attention to spills can help maintain the carpet's appearance and prolong its lifespan. Some woolen carpets may require professional cleaning, so it's important to know the cleaning recommendations of the manufacturer.
